It was an emotional moment for Rihanna last night as she accepted the Glamour Magazine "Back on Top Superstar" award and was named Glamour Magazine's Woman of 2009! Rihanna walked on to stage wiping away the tears and thanked all her friends and family helping her through this tough year, where she was dealing with a lot of heartache and pain and publicity because of the domestic violence drama with her and now ex Chris Brown. As usual Rihanna was sweet and dignified in her speech, especially for someone who has only just turned 21! Take a look at her introduction and speech:

Chris Brown released his debut album in 2005 and has since then had much success as an artist, producer and actor. Already at the age of 16 his debut singel Run it! made it to the no 1 n the Bilboard. Chris Brown has starred in the TV-show O.C.

While Rihanna has agreed to do only one interview with Diane Sawyer and Good Morning America her ex Chris Brown has already done three! The other day the singer met with MTV News correspondant Sway to address the part of Rihanna's interview that has already aired on TV and said that he's already come clean about everything and is not scared that his ex will tell anything new. He also said that while he respects Rihanna's decision to discuss specific events he still feels some details should be kept private. Rihanna has finally spoken out about her feelings surrounding her abusive relationship with Chris Brown! She sat down with Diane Sawyer and told how embarrassed she was that she fell so deeply in love with a guy who would hurt her like that and that she could never live with herself if other girls in her situation took their boyfriends back! Wow we weren't expecting her to be that brutally honest! In the mean time Chris has given a 3rd interview apologising for his behaviour, this time on MTV. Here is a clip from the Rihanna interview. News just in, Rihanna is ready to talk! The singer is giving her first interview since her domestic violence scandal broke earlier this year when ex boyfriend Chris Brown assaulted her. Rihanna sat down with famous interviewer Diane Sawyer and told her side of the story for the first time. The interview will air on Thursday where Rihanna will talk openly about her family and background, how Chris was her first big love and how she has been doing over the last nine months since the assault. Last night in New Jersey exciting things happened! Chris Brown performed live for the first time since the Rihanna-domestic violence scandal hit earlier this year! Chris sang at the Power 105 Powerhouse event and he really pulled out all the stops with his costumes, dancing and performance! Wow, anyone can see he is hungry move on! The performance came on the same day his new video "I can transform ya" debuted. Take a look at it below:
